Ajax

    Level 3 : 5~8 (ajax, json, array, sort)

    5. 카드레이아웃에 데이터를 불러와 카드 3개 생성하기 원시자바스크립트버전 let cardWrap = document.querySelector('.row'); let products = [ { id : 0, price : 70000, title : 'Blossom Dress' }, { id : 1, price : 50000, title : 'Springfield Shirt' }, { id : 2, price : 60000, title : 'Black Monastery' } ]; products.forEach(function(a, i){ let card = ` ${products[i]['title']} ${products[i]['price']} ` cardWrap.insertAdjacentHTML('bef..

    [코딩애플] ajax로 서버와 데이터 주고받기 (1)

    서버에 요청하는 법 어떤 데이터인지 url을 제대로 작성한다 (틀린 url로 요청시 404error가 뜬다) 어떤 방법으로 요청할지 결정한다 (GET/POST .. PUT, DELETE 등) GET GET 요청은 서버에 있던 데이터를 읽고 싶을 때 주로 사용한다. 브라우저 주소창에 url을 적으면 그곳으로 GET 요청을 날린다. POST POST 요청은 서버로 데이터를 보내고 싶을 때 주로 사용한다. POST 요청을 날리고 싶으면 form 태그 + method="post" + action="url"을 이용하면 된다. GET과 POST는 요청하면 브라우저가 새로고침된다. AJAX 서버에 GET, POST 요청을 할 때 새로고침 없이 데이터를 주고받을 수 있게 도와주는 브라우저 기능이다. (ex. 댓글을 서..